1992 CENSUS OF AGRICULTURE HIGHLIGHTS OF AGRICULTURE: 1992 AND 1987 ZAVALA COUNTY, TEXAS Item ALL FARMS 1992 1987 Farms .........................number.. 247 272 Land in farms ..................acres.. 723 018 825 843 Average size of farm .......acres.. 2 927 3 036 Value of land and buildings@1: Average per farm .........dollars.. 979 846 1 261 732 Average per acre .........dollars.. 337 411 Estimated market value of all machinery and equipment@1 Average per farm .........dollars.. 55 347 53 023 Farms by size: 1 to 9 acres ........................ 5 13 10 to 49 acres ...................... 8 9 50 to 179 acres ..................... 36 40 180 to 499 acres .................... 47 65 500 to 999 acres .................... 47 39 1,000 acres or more ................. 104 106 Total cropland .................farms.. 160 158 acres.. 72 776 67 278 Harvested cropland ...........farms.. 108 116 acres.. 41 348 38 331 Irrigated land .................farms.. 56 72 acres.. 22 808 25 519 Market value of agricultural products sold................$1,000.. 37 316 45 951 Average per farm .........dollars.. 151 075 168 937 Crops, including nursery and greenhouse crops............$1,000.. 17 580 16 471 Livestock, poultry, and their products....................$1,000.. 19 736 29 480 Farms by value of sales: Less than $2,500 .................... 46 33 $2,500 to $4,999 .................... 19 33 $5,000 to $9,999 .................... 36 37 $10,000 to $24,999 .................. 35 38 $25,000 to $49,999 .................. 20 20 $50,000 to $99,999 .................. 23 38 $100,000 or more .................... 68 73 Total farm production expenses.$1,000.. 31 227 38 141 Average per farm .........dollars.. 125 917 140 226 Net cash return from agricultural sales for the farm unit.......farms.. 248 272 $1,000.. 5 881 11 667 Average per farm..........dollars.. 23 715 42 892 Operators by principal occupation: Farming ............................. 142 139 Other ............................... 105 133 Operators by days worked off farm: Any ................................. 120 161 200 days or more ................... 84 100 Livestock and poultry: Cattle and calves inventory...farms.. 171 184 number.. 45 104 65 922 Beef cows ..................farms.. 148 166 number.. 13 273 (D) Milk cows ..................farms.. 7 5 number.. 146 (D) Cattle and calves sold .......farms.. 172 188 number.. 32 108 60 917 Hogs and pigs inventory ......farms.. 2 9 number.. (D) (D) Hogs and pigs sold ...........farms.. 2 6 number.. (D) 1 005 Sheep and lambs inventory ....farms.. 2 3 number.. (D) (D) Chickens 3 months old or older inventory.............farms.. 4 8 number.. 79 533 Broilers and other meat-type chickens sold...............farms.. 0 0 number.. 0 0 Selected crops harvested: Corn for grain or seed .......farms.. 21 36 acres.. 4 175 6 993 bushels.. 437 756 582 248 Sorghum for grain or seed.....farms.. 24 38 acres.. 7 083 6 114 bushels.. 426 213 420 322 Wheat for grain ..............farms.. 36 38 acres.. 8 328 4 080 bushels.. 180 199 97 327 Rice..........................farms.. 0 0 acres.. 0 0 cwt.. 0 0 Cotton .......................farms.. 28 36 acres.. 5 387 7 938 bales.. 6 744 12 941 Soybeans for beans ...........farms.. 0 0 acres.. 0 0 bushels.. 0 0 Hay-alf, other, wild, silage..farms.. 44 34 acres.. 4 363 3 541 tons, dry.. 5 008 6 516 @1Data are based on a sample of farms. Legend: - Represents zero (D) Withheld to avoid disclosing data for individual farms (X) Not applicable (Z) Less than half the unit shown (NA) Not available Source: 1992 Census of Agriculture, Volume 1 Geographic Area Series, "Table 1. County Summary Highlights: 1992." This electronic series presents summary statistics for each county and state together with comparable data from the 1987 census. The items included are the same for all states and counties, except selected crops harvested, which vary by state. Data for 1992 and 1987 are directly comparable for acreage and inventories. Dollar values have not been adjusted for changes in price levels.
